Mitchell Park Neighborhood Overview
Welcome to Mitchell Park
Mitchell Park is a historic neighborhood on Milwaukee's near south side, anchored by its namesake park and the iconic Mitchell Park Horticultural Conservatory, known locally as "The Domes." The area is characterized by a mix of residential streets and commercial corridors, offering a dense, urban living experience. Its central location provides residents with convenient access to downtown Milwaukee and other city neighborhoods.
Lifestyle & Amenities
The neighborhood's crown jewel is Mitchell Park, home to the unique glass-domed conservatories that host botanical displays and community events. Daily needs are met along nearby West Historic Mitchell Street, which features a variety of local shops, restaurants, and services reflecting the area's cultural diversity. The park itself provides recreational space with walking paths, sports facilities, and picnic areas for residents.
Real Estate Market
The real estate market in Mitchell Park is notably affordable, with a median home value of $93,900 according to U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ates (2022). The neighborhood primarily consists of historic single-family homes, including bungalows and two-story frames, along with multi-unit buildings. This affordability makes it an accessible entry point into Milwaukee's housing market for first-time buyers and investors.
Schools & Education
Mitchell Park is served by Milwaukee Public Schools, which operates several elementary, middle, and high schools in and around the neighborhood. Families have access to a range of public school options, including some specialty and language programs. The area is also in close proximity to several higher education institutions, including Milwaukee Area Technical College and the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ee.
Transportation & Connectivity
The neighborhood is well-served by the Milwaukee County Transit System, with multiple bus lines running along major thoroughfares like West Historic Mitchell Street and South 27th Street, providing direct routes to downtown and other districts. Mitchell Park's central location offers quick access to major highways, including I-94 and I-43, facilitating regional travel. The walkable street grid and bike-friendly routes also support local commuting.
